Gameplay Summary

The game began with all four players casting their commanders early, setting the stage for diverse strategies.

Kimahri utilized his ability to become a copy of opponent creatures, gaining versatility and control.

G'raha Tia focused on casting non-creature spells, paying life to generate multiple 1/1 hero tokens with lifelink, aiming to overwhelm opponents with a growing army.

Tidus leveraged plus one plus one counters and proliferate mechanics to grow his creatures and draw cards, while also incorporating a secondary theme involving charge counters.

Noctis centered his deck around artifact reanimation synergy, aiming to establish infinite loops and dominate the board with powerful artifact creatures. A key turning point was the deployment of significant board control elements such as Supreme Verdict, which was countered by Fierce Guardianship, showcasing the high-stakes interaction between players.

Multiple proliferate effects and counter manipulations fueled the growth of creatures on the battlefield, while combat phases saw strategic attacks and defenses based on board states and life totals.

The players demonstrated careful resource management and timing, especially with life payment and equipment usage to protect commanders and maintain pressure.

The game unfolded as a dynamic contest of tempo, board presence, and synergy exploitation, with no single player dominating early, highlighting the balanced but interactive nature of the match.
